5mm Hardmetal Tungsten Carbide Grinding Ball
Product Overview Tungsten carbide grinding balls are essential tools for sample preparation in Fritsch Planetary Mills. These 5mm balls are placed inside grinding bowls along with the material to be ground. The high density and extreme hardness of tungsten carbide make these balls ideal for pulverizing hard, abrasive samples, significantly reducing processing time and preventing sample contamination.
How Grinding Balls Work The final particle size of your sample is influenced by several factors, including the size and number of grinding balls used.
- Ball Size: As a general rule, larger balls are used for coarse grinding, while smaller balls produce a finer end product. For optimal results, avoid mixing different ball sizes in the same grinding process.
- Ball Quantity: Increasing the number of balls can decrease grinding time and create a finer, more uniform particle size distribution. However, it's crucial not to overfill the grinding bowl. For effective grinding action, the total volume of the balls and sample should not exceed two-thirds of the bowl's capacity, leaving one-third of the space empty.
Material Selection To prevent contamination and ensure efficient grinding, the grinding media (bowls and balls) should always be harder than the sample material.
- Tungsten Carbide: Recommended for grinding very hard or tough materials due to its exceptional wear resistance.
- Mixing Materials: In certain situations, using tungsten carbide balls in steel bowls or zirconium oxide balls in corundum bowls can enhance grinding performance. However, be aware that using dissimilar materials for bowls and balls increases the risk of cross-contamination from abrasion.

Determining the ideal ball size and quantity often requires experimentation based on your specific material and desired outcome. User trials are the most effective way to optimize your grinding process.
